Microsoft Publisher
Microsoft Publisher is a simple and economical tool for desktop page design, specialized in designing professional print and digital materials there’s no requirement to utilize complex design tools. Unlike conventional text editors, publisher allows for more precise placement of elements and easier design adjustments. The software includes a broad collection of ready templates and adjustable layout configurations, that support users in quickly launching projects without design expertise.
Microsoft OneNote
Microsoft OneNote is a virtual note-taking tool designed to facilitate fast and easy gathering, storing, and organizing of notes, thoughts, and ideas. It unites the flexibility of a classic notebook with the features of cutting-edge software: here, you can write, insert images, audio, links, and tables. OneNote can be used effectively for personal notes, school, work, and group projects. Through integration with Microsoft 365 cloud, records are automatically synchronized on all devices, providing access to data anywhere and anytime, whether on a computer, tablet, or smartphone.
Microsoft Excel
One of the most comprehensive tools for dealing with numerical and tabular data is Microsoft Excel. Worldwide, it is used for managing reports, data analysis, forecasting, and data visualization. Thanks to its versatile range—from simple computations to advanced formulas and automation— from routine tasks to sophisticated analysis in business, science, and education, Excel meets all needs. The program simplifies the process of making and editing spreadsheets, format the data according to specified criteria, and perform sorting and filtering.
